Woman, with 5 kids in van, leads St. Louis police on chase

ST. LOUIS (AP) - A woman is in custody in St. Louis after a leading police on a chase while her five children were inside the minivan. A pedestrian was struck during the chase that ended when the minivan struck the Edward Jones Dome in downtown St. Louis.

KTVI-TV (http://bit.ly/ODerYC ) reports that police in Wellston responded to a shoplifting report on Tuesday. The suspect fled in a white minivan and slammed into a police car. The officer was not seriously hurt.

The chase went into St. Louis, where the van struck a pedestrian, who is hospitalized in guarded condition. It ended when the van struck the dome. Police say the woman ran, leaving behind the five children, including a baby. She was quickly captured.

The children were not injured.
